This I Believe, Music by Bethany Rexus

This I believe in Music. The art of music has been used to entertain and bring together people since the beginning of time. It touches a part of your soul that noone can explain, and can bring out the worst or best in people, and as said by Aldous Huxley "After silence, that which comes nearest to expressing the inexpressible is music." Music can be used to express, Love, hate, heartache and sadness. Many artists not only use there music as there living, but there escape, there drug and there healer. For example country singer Reba McEntire said, quote. "For me, singing sad songs often has a way of healing a situation. It gets the hurt out in the open into the light, out of the darkness." I cannot agree more with Reba, as a fairly music oriented person myself, singing and song writing can be used as a method of healing or expression. Writing the song and singing the lyrics helps get out the inner turmoil the artist is dealing with, and overall those songs sung from the heart, are some of the most succesfull. For example, Poisons hit song, still played on the radio today, "Every Rose has its thorn" from there second album "Open up and say - Ahh!" was written by lead singer Bret Michael. Michaels said the inspiration for the song came from a night when he was in a laundromat waiting for his clothes to dry, and called his girlfriend on a pay phone. Michaels said he heard a male voice in the background and was devastated; he said he went into the laundromat and wrote "Every Rose Has Its Thorn" as a result. Its almost silly, thinking that something such as a girl cheating on you could open up your creative musical mind to write a hit like that. But Poison is not alone in this, many bands and artists throughout history have written there sadness and love sick filled songs that have climbed the charts and made them known, when at the same time healing there broken selves.
